Asics Italia S.R.L. is seeking an Assistant Store Manager for their Bridgend location. In this role, you will drive the store's performance, support the Store Manager in maximizing sales, and assist in team development.

We are looking for a retail expert with around 2 years of management experience, strong communication skills, and a customer-oriented mindset.

The company promotes well-being through resources like mindfulness sessions and wellness programs.

How to prepare for a job interview at Asics Italia S.R.L.

Know Your Numbers

Before the interview, brush up on your sales figures and performance metrics from your previous roles. Being able to discuss how you drove sales and improved team performance will show that you're results-oriented and ready to contribute.

Showcase Your Leadership Style

Think about examples from your past management experience where you successfully developed your team. Be prepared to share specific stories that highlight your communication skills and how you foster a positive work environment.

Align with Company Values

Asics promotes well-being, so it’s important to express your understanding of this value. Share any experiences you have with wellness initiatives or how you’ve supported team members in maintaining a healthy work-life balance.

Prepare Questions

Have a few thoughtful questions ready for the interviewer. This could be about their approach to team development or how they measure store performance. It shows your genuine interest in the role and helps you assess if it's the right fit for you.
